Kit straightened their back as they stared down at the track, annoyance flickering in their eyes at Ozma's response. This kid.. This kid would just not shut up would he? Spouting off his mouth about things he didn't even have a clue about, telling them they were being excessive, trying to lecture them about the way they were training their recruits. He had no idea. And thanks to his little display it was going to take a lot longer to teach everyone now.

They reached to their pocket, pulled out a box and flicked a Cigarette into their hand, fumbling with it, they lit up the end and placed the tip in their mouth, leaning back slightly and lighting the tip with a lighter. Taking a dragon of the cigarette, they let out a stream of smoke into the air before flicking some ash to the side with practiced ease, "Oz here wants to ask more questions and keep spouting off his mouth." they hummed, becoming almost cat-like in mannerisms as they let the cheshire grin spread across their face. "So while before I was going to give you guys a few laps around the track. Now i'm going to run you until you puke."

They motioned to the track. "Go on then. Get moving."

Another puff on their cigarette, blowing the smoke into the air as the stress seemed to only intensify on their shoulders. "I had you pegged completely wrong kid. Thought that you were the self-sacrificing sort. Thought for sure you might try and shoulder the responsibility yourself, take your own punishment. Looks like I was wrong, its kind of a let down." They find a bench near the track and ease themself down into it, humming to themself before tapping the bench as if welcoming Ozma to sit beside them.

Not waiting for a response, they lean back on the bench. "This makes you mad I bet." they puff on their cigarette again, blowing the smoke into the air as if they were some kind of weird train. "You probably hate me." a wheezing laugh escaped from their chest as they blew out another plume of smoke. "Its just so amusing to me that you think a brat like you thinks he knows everything."

Max was.. notably.. saddened that Adrielle hadn't really seemed too keen on him. He'd just been trying to make friends with her. Talk with her a little. Apparently she was bitter about being here. Well that was pretty obvious. I mean, he wasn't fond of it either.. but he had no choice so he was trying to make the best of it, all things considered.

When Kit snapped at Ozma, he didn't really know what to think. He'd never been an athletic guy, so running.. well it wasn't his favorite task for sure. He could see irritation and anger in the eyes of some of the others. Biting his lip, he strode up to Kit and Ozma carefully, straightening his back and shoulders. He caught the last snippets of conversation and watched as Kit puffed on a cigarette. Kit did have a point. Ozma had kind of caused all of this... well. no.. Kit had caused all of this.. But Ozma had kept it going for longer than necessary. He probably hadn't meant to considering he didn't know Kit. well.. none of them knew Kit.

It didn't seem right, it never seemed right.. and he had to do something.

Clearing his throat, he stood tall and strong as Kit focused their eyes on him. "You are supposed to be running, Maxwell...or do you really want to be a troublemaker like our dear Ozma here?"

Max was a hundred percent certain he'd never introduced himself on the bus as Maxwell. Staring at Kit for a moment in confusion, he managed to keep his composure. "Uhm.. excuse me. Sorry. I would like to offer to take the entire punishment myself."

Kit gave him a surprised look, obviously not expecting that. "Really?"

Max nodded and gestured to his pudgy body. "I'm fat. So i can use the exercise anyways."

Kit looked a mixture between amused and content. "Good point." They smiled. "Okay kiddies. If anyone wants to opt out of running, they can feel free to. Maxwell here is going to run your laps for you if you leave, along with his own." They paused. "Oh and Ozma, my friend. You aren't going anywhere. You get to be my arm candy for the rest of the day."

Maxwell already hated himself for offering to do this. But he'd made a choice, and it was time he stuck to it. He was turning eighteen in a few weeks anyways. He had to learn to be a man and shoulder some responsibility. That's how his dad had always taught him after all.

Devon had barely got to the track before Kit announced they were going to make them run until they puked. No, no, no, no, no. Puke was the ultimate dirt and Devon tried his best to avoid it. He started walking reluctantly around the track, not daring to go any faster in case he tripped. "Clothes can be washed," he assured himself quietly. "Everything can be cleaned. Besides, Kit won't really make you puke." Will they? Actually, the more he thought about it the more likely it seemed. He wanted to cry or scream or yell. Mostly he wanted to shove Ozma and Kit right into the mud.

And then some other kid goes off chatting with Kit as if that has never caused problems before. His immediate thought was, Great, now we have to run until we drop dead. His gaze further turned disapproving as he noticed the cigarette in his instructor's hand. Didn't they know how bad that was for their health? Devon was growing so frustrated he didn't notice he was walking faster to the extent he practically was running. God, he hated this. He wanted to know what they were talking about. Maybe if he tried hard enough he'd have a heart attack and never have to run again.

Devon couldn't help but beam as Kit announced they didn't have to run laps anymore. He'd barely finished one, but it had definitely been the worst lap of his life. Not because it was tiring, just because his thoughts were consuming. He had been trying incessantly to not hate Ozma so early on for such a petty reason, but the more Kit piled on, the more impossible that appeared. He noticed Asha then join that conversation. Considering she was the only person he really knew, and she had been pretty eager to run in the first place, Devon didn't feel very guilty about not wanting to do laps. His smile faded quickly though. Should he be feeling guilty? Well, it wasn't really Devon's fault in the first place. It wasn't really Max or Asha's either, but they at least were doing it willingly.

Don't look at them. You'll change your mind. You don't like running and you need to unpack. Still, he did feel pretty babyish being the first one not offering to share the punishment. If the punishment was mopping floors or something he wouldn't have hesitated. But running outside on a field took everything he hated and squashed it into one big event. When he walked past them all, Devon stopped. This was really rude. He had almost not even thanked them. Asha looked like she was waiting to get back on the track. Max didn't appear so pleased. Devon tried not to think about it. "Thank you," he said to the pair. "That's very noble of you." From his tone it was clear he wasn't feeling noble. He did actually appreciate it, though.

With that, Devon stood at the door. Now, this was a problem. If he went inside he'd be trailing dirt all over the place, and people, including himself, had to live here. If he didn't, he'd probably just get stared at. He wasn't even that dirty, but it was enough to make him wait for someone else to go inside while messy, or for someone to tell him to go in; that way, he'd know it was okay. Everyone's going to think you're a freak.

He had no idea what had been going through the instructors head, but was deathly apparent to Ozma that he certainly couldn't read people even when it was so plainly in front of him. He'd asked a simple question, a curiosity he could have easily disregaurded and then been dropped, but no. He continued to lash out at them all, snapping the whole way.

He wasn't trying to ridicule the man-- who was certainly giving off the vibe he couldn't handle kids, at least at the moment-- he was only trying to understand. They knew nothing about their teacher, but their teacher had asked them all to share. Sure he had shared his event, but trust was a mutual thing. He couldn't just expect them all to trust him going only off that and the way he acted towards them currently. It was begining to look as though that is all Kit ever wanted to do: train them. There was no room for watching out for them, there was no caring, there was not anything. They were to be warriors, to be an army of robots who followed without question. Don't have feelings, or at least don't show them you stupid eighteen year old. Don't you remember anything your father told you?

'Just stand there and shut up'.

He could have offered an explination. That taking on the punishment and pressing forward only seemed aggrivate the instructor more, so he wouldn't because he didn't want anyone hurt more. But he didn't, he'd just stand there and look like he was invapable of feeling much of anything. He would stop for their sake, but they'd never know that. They'd all continue to hate him if they already did and he'd be the one they could all pick apart when they got bored and needed a chewtoy. All because as always he preoccupied on what would happen to others above himself.

One thing that was becoming painfully clear to him was that adults were awful. He'd never met one he could trust, he'd never met anyone older than him that was kind. Asking for someone to be nice to tou was a crime apparently, too much for any of them to handle. You're no ones equal, you're an ends to a mean. Always have been, always will be. To your parents, to their inheritance, and now to Kit.

The only person older than him that'd ever shown him any shred of sencirity in being nice was Gene. Something told him that she was coming from a similar place to him though, not exactly ideal no matter how well off you might have been. Maybe they could come to confide in one another, that is assuming she didn't want to slap him after all of this.

What's worse is he felt his heart drop at the idea of having to be near Kit, especially for the rest of the day. He was true in saying he'd listen to the man for training, but other than that he wanted to be as far away as possible from the man. He'd be reserved to the man, and vowed internally to never ever treat any of the others here like that no matter how cruel they were to him. Because they were young, life was hard, and this was a war. Who would you be able to count on if not for your team? Better yet he thought it absurd the man thought he knew everything. He'd just been asking questions not a moment earlier, how did that at all constitute as 'knowing everything'?

And yet he still refused to defend himself if only so the others wouldn't suffer for it. If Kit wasn't going to mature about this, then Oz would do as he always had. He'd stand there, look pretty, and let everyone think whatever they wanted about him, because whether they liked it or not everything he did was in anyone's best interest.

He shot an apologetic look to the few that had come over and offered to take all the punishment for the others. He wanted to himself, but he kept his mouth shut because it was obvious Kit would only make it worse anymore. Instead he opted to stay right where he was and fold his hands behind his back, and decided to be the villain because what good would come out of them mistrusting their mentor? For all he knew if they mistrusted Kit, they wouldn't follow them into battle or obey them in despirate situations like Ozma still would.

So lucky for Kit, Ozma had been playing the part of 'good little robot' his entire life and probably knew how to do it better than anyone here.

Kit stared at the steadily growing group before them, an amused smile drifting across their face. The kids seemed so eager now. And it was.. very interesting to be honest. Taking a slow drag on their cigarette they blew out a puff of smoke, eyes twinkling with life. "Well well well." They drawled. "Certainly is a fun turn of events now, isn't it." They were a bit irritated by the sound of sponebob playing from Angela's chair.. but they weren't going to do anything about it if what they had heard about her abilities was really true.

They stared at the track, tapping their foot and humming as they leaned back to stare at the sky. Blue.. cloudless. it was a nice day. "In that case. How about seven laps a piece." they drawled. "Except for you Percy. With your Speedy Gonzalez thing going on you should still finish before everyone else does. Honestly, its not even a punishment for you. Maybe i should make you write lines or something instead." They tapped their face. "Eh. you can just run double everyone else, not like it matters much."

Kit moved their head back so they were looking at each kid again. "Thanks to Maxwell, the punishment is back to what it was before Oz the great and powerful here decided to mess with me."

Kit laughed as Adrielle ran off her mouth to them. "I'm unfair. So is the world kid." they snorted. "Now, because of your mouth, you kiddies get to wake up niiiice and early tomorrow and do this running thing again. This time its you who will sit out and watch while everyone else runs."

They sucked on the last of their cigarette, spraying ash to the wind as they threw the butt on the ground and stomped it with their foot. "You kiddies clearly aren't getting the lesson here, so I guess I have to spell it out for you word by word. In this place. I'm the law. Whatever I say goes. You will respect me, and you will not question anything I say. Because like it or not, kiddies. I'm your best shot at getting through this stuff alive. I've raised little snots like you into fine warriors, teams who actually can defeat Triggered. So, If I say jump, you say how high, if i say run, you say how far, if i say fling yourself off a building, you better goddamn do it." They stood tall and strong, looming over the kids. "And you can back talk me all you want behind my back, talk about how unfair I am and how cruel I am. I really don't care. But to my face, none of you are to question how I do things. You're to fall in line, shut up and listen."

Kit grinned, a crooked grin that spread across their face. "That's only if you want to live though. If you really want to die, its fine with me. Do what you want. See where that gets you." They gestured to the track. "Go on then kiddos. Its run or die."
